Pet Adoption League of Gem County

We are a non-profit animal shelter ran by animal loving volunteers. We are a no kill shelter. We spay and neuter all our pets before adopting out. Our goal here is to return lost pets to their owners, find homes for those who have none, and promote compassionate treatment of animals everywhere.

Meet Zeke

Meet Zeke Personality: Zeke may look intimidating at first glance with his large size (115 lbs.) and strong physique, but spend just a few moments with him and you'll quickly realize he's a big goofball at heart. He's a gentle giant who adores the company of people and other animals alike. Zeke is a well-mannered dog; he's mastered all the basic commands like sit, stay, down, and shake hands, and he's eager to learn even more. He walks calmly by your side, making him an ideal companion for leisurely strolls around the neighborhood or relaxing hikes in the great outdoors. Ideal Home: Zeke is longing for a family to call his own, but he's looking for someone who can be with him most of the time. If you work from home or are retired and seeking a devoted canine companion to keep you company throughout the day, Zeke might be the perfect match for you. He's the type of dog who loves nothing more than curling up at your feet while you work, offering quiet companionship and unwavering loyalty. Despite his size, Zeke is excellent with kids and other animals. Adoption Process
We have a 1 page adoption form. We do home visits on all of our dogs. Our adoption fee is $80.00 for dogs and $50.00 for cats. That includes spay/neuter and vaccines.
